How to Find Items You Will Love on thredUP

  • Get Specific

This is probably my number one piece of advice I have for finding something you will love on thredUP! I am all about searching for specific brands but I’ve stumbled upon some new-to-me brands I ended up loving on thredUP by searching for specific items. This is especially handy when I want to try out a new trend but I’m not looking to spend a ton of money on certain items.

By searching for specific items like a denim vest, black and white romper, pink crop top or floppy hat, I can find specific items I’m interested in purchasing without limiting myself to the brands or stores I frequent in my day-to-day life.

  • Search For Your Favorite Brands

When it comes to shopping for clothes, most of us have brands we know and love. There are a handful of brands I shop for over and over again because I know I can usually find something that will both flatter my body type and match my personal style. I will often search thredUP specifically for these brands and since I am very familiar with my size in clothing from my favorite brands, it helps me find items that are often a hit! For example, I love the brand Yumi Kim and know the dresses from this brand are typically feminine and flattering to my body type.

  • Search By Style/Fit

Most of us know what fits flatter our body type, so searching thredUP for certain items by specific style is very helpful! I know fit and flare is a style that generally works well on my body type since I have wider hips and a booty but am a little slimmer through the waist, so I search for this fit when I look for dresses. When it comes to items like jeans or shorts, searching by style (skinny, high-waisted, cropped, etc.) can be very helpful and narrow your search to a more manageable amount of items to browse.

  • Check Back Often

When I was searching for a black backpack, I checked thredUP quite often since I figured a black backpack is an item that’s not too obscure and would likely pop up on the site semi-frequently. thredUP is updated ALL THE TIME (they add thousands of items per hour) so new items constantly appear on the site. When I have something specific in mind that I know is a relatively popular item, I peek around the site and search for a specific item and more often than not, I’ll luck out and something will appear within a couple of weeks.

    I cannot stay silent on this post…stay away from ThredUp. They are paying well-known bloggers for favorable reviews because they are trying to rebuild their reputation. My sister is a blogger, and her fellow fashion bloggers have shown me the payments from ThredUp in exchange for favorable reviews.

    I sent in several bags of barely worn items from Banana Republic, J. Crew, Madewell, Lands’ End, etc. etc. – brands they definitely accept, and a good chunk were new with tags. I received a whopping payout of 33 cents a piece for 5 pairs of jeans, $4.00 for everything else; they of course marked these items up over 1000% to make a profit, and donated pieces without contacting me first. This was after waiting 3 + months to hear about what had happened to my things!! I could go on and on. Sell your clothes yourselves or drop them off at a local thrift store for a tax write-off.

    Their “customer service” is a total joke. It makes me sick how much money I lost and I have been waiting for a resolution for a long time, to no avail. I started to piece everything together, hence my knowledge of payments to bloggers within my sister’s circle.
